2. Direct flights from Bangkok to domestic cities

Chongqing. Chongqing flies directly to Bangkok. Air China flies every Saturday, and the round-trip fare ranges from 2200 to 2600 yuan. Since many tours are contracted by travel agencies, you can directly consult the major travel agencies in Chongqing. The transfer price from Chengdu to Bangkok is around 3200 yuan. Chongqing flies to Bangkok via Hong Kong. With Dragonair, you can stop over in Hong Kong for no more than 7 days, and the fare is between 3,200 and 3,500 yuan. The service of this line is the best.

According to the Immigration Law of Thailand, China citizens who meet one of the following conditions can apply for immigration to Thailand: their spouses or parents (including adoptive parents) are Thai citizens, unmarried children (including adopted children) under the age of 20 are Thai citizens, brothers and sisters are Thai citizens, and other special circumstances stipulated in the Immigration Law of Thailand.

Those who meet the above conditions may entrust their relatives and friends living in Thailand to apply to the Immigration Bureau of Thailand; Or the applicant can apply to the Thai Embassy in China with relevant documents.

From Thailand to China, the general freight is:

Goods under 5 kg each time 1000 baht. After arriving in Kunming, it will be forwarded by downwind express, and the domestic postage will be paid.

Goods over 5 kg 10 kg are 2000 baht each time. After arriving in Kunming, it will be forwarded by SF Express, and the domestic postage will be collected.

Above 10KG -42KG, 3000 baht each time, and then forward it to SF or Debon Logistics, to pay the freight and China.

70 baht per kilogram over 42kg to Kunming, then transfer to SF or Debon Logistics, to pay the freight, China.
